#74472f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#74472f is composed of 45.5% red, 27.8%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 59.5%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 20.9 degrees, a saturation of 42.3% and a lightness of 32%. #74472f color hex could be obtained by blending #e88e5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#74472f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#74472f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#55514e is the less saturated color, while #a03a03 is the most saturated one.
